What Makes Legal SEO Different from General SEO?
Law firm SEO isn’t simply plugging in keywords and waiting. Legal searches carry what Google classifies as “Your Money or Your Life” (YMYL) intent — meaning the stakes are high, and Google holds legal content to an exceptionally strict standard of expertise, authoritativeness, and trustworthiness (E-E-A-T).
Authority Signals Google Looks For
– Attorney bio pages that list bar admissions, case experience, and credentials clearly.
– Backlinks from the Virginia State Bar directory, legal association sites, and local Chesapeake or Hampton Roads news outlets.
– Practice area pages written with genuine legal depth — not thin paragraphs that could apply to any state in the country.
Trust Signals That Convert Visitors into Clients
– Authentic Google reviews from Chesapeake clients, consistently earned over time.
– A fast, mobile-first website — critical when many searchers are on a phone in a stressful moment.
– Clear contact information, office hours, and a prominent call-to-action on every page.
Google’s Search Central documentation emphasizes that pages should demonstrate real expertise. For law firms, that means your content must go beyond surface-level explanations of legal concepts and reflect the actual way Virginia law works in Chesapeake Circuit Court or Chesapeake General District Court.
The Local Map Pack: Your Most Valuable Real Estate in Chesapeake
The Google Business Profile (GBP) map pack — the three listings that appear with a map at the top of local search results — drives an enormous share of law firm inquiries. Ranking there requires a fully optimized GBP, a consist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one) presence across directories, and genuine local reviews.
For Chesapeake law firms, this means your GBP must list your Chesapeake office address accurately, select the most precise legal categories, and regularly post updates. A firm that posts weekly — answering common legal questions relevant to Chesapeake residents — signals to Google that the listing is active and authoritative. Building a Content Strategy That Ranks in Chesapeake’s Legal Market
Generic blog posts about “what to do after a car accident” rank for nothing competitive. What works in Chesapeake is content tied to the real local landscape — Virginia traffic laws enforced on Route 17 through Chesapeake, the jurisdiction of Chesapeake Circuit Court for family law matters, or how Virginia’s contributory negligence rule affects personal injury cases in this region.
Practice Area Pages vs. Blog Content
Every major practice area deserves its own dedicated page — not a paragraph buried in an “About” section. A personal injury firm in Chesapeake should have separate, optimized pages for car accidents, slip-and-fall cases, wrongful death claims, and workers’ compensation. Each page targets a distinct keyword cluster and serves a distinct searcher intent.
Blog content complements those pages by targeting longer-tail queries: “how long do I have to file a personal injury claim in Virginia,” “what happens at a Chesapeake General District Court hearing,” or “can I get a DUI expunged in Virginia.” These posts attract searchers early in their decision-making process and build your firm’s topical authority over time.

Technical SEO: The Foundation Chesapeake Law Firms Often Skip
Content and local signals can only do so much if the underlying website is slow, broken, or hard for Google to crawl. Technical SEO issues are especially common on law firm websites built on outdated templates or patched together over years without a unified strategy.
Key technical areas to address:
– Core Web Vitals: Google measures page speed, visual stability, and interactivity. A sluggish website loses both rankings and prospective clients who click away.
– Mobile usability: Most legal searches happen on smartphones. If your site is hard to navigate on mobile, you’re losing the searcher at the most critical moment.
– Schema markup: Legal-specific structured data (LocalBusiness, Attorney, FAQPage) helps Google understand your firm’s services and can generate rich search results that stand out on the page.

Link Building for Chesapeake Law Firms: Quality Over Quantity
Backlinks remain one of Google’s strongest ranking signals — and for law firms, the quality of those links matters far more than the quantity. A link from the Virginia State Bar, a citation in a Hampton Roads news story, or a sponsorship mention from a Chesapeake community event carries real weight. Random directory links from low-authority sites do almost nothing.
Effective link-building strategies for Chesapeake attorneys include:
– Contributing legal commentary to outlets like The Virginian-Pilot or local Chesapeake news sites.
– Building relationships with complementary local professionals (real estate agents, financial advisors) who may refer and link to your site.
– Sponsoring or participating in Chesapeake community events, which often earn a website mention from the organization.
– Getting listed in reputable legal directories like Avvo, Justia, and FindLaw, which also serve as strong citation signals.

Do Chesapeake law firms really need a separate page for each practice area?
Yes. Google ranks individual pages, not websites as a whole. A single “Services” page that lists all your practice areas in one place rarely ranks well for any individual keyword. Dedicated pages for each practice area allow you to target specific search terms, provide deeper content, and build authority around each legal specialty.
What’s the difference between organic SEO and the Google map pack for law firms?
Organic SEO refers to the traditional blue-link results below the map pack. The map pack (also called the local 3-pack) shows three local business listings with a map at the top of many local searches. Both are valuable. Organic rankings build long-term traffic for informational and practice-area queries; the map pack drives direct calls and consultations from high-intent local searchers. A complete strategy targets both.
How important are Google reviews for a Chesapeake law firm’s SEO?
Reviews are a significant factor in local map pack rankings. The number of reviews, recency, star rating, and whether you respond to reviews all influence where your firm appears in Chesapeake local searches. Beyond rankings, reviews also influence whether a prospective client chooses to contact your firm after finding you online.
